MASTERTON COUNTY. * N Extraordinary Vacancy h&3 occurred in the representation o£ the. Alfredton Riding, through the resignation by Councillor Holmes Warren of his seat in the Masterton County Council, and notice is hereby given that an election to fill the said vacancy w*ll be held on THURSDAY, the 3rd day of January, 1007. I hereby appoint THURSDAY, the 27th •day of Dscember, 1906, at 4 p.m., as the time, and the County Office, Masterton, as the place for receiving nominations of Candidates for the said office. Forms of nomination may be obtained at the Post Office, Alfredton, and Waterfalls Homestead, or from the undersigned. Notice of the situation of the polling booths, and the hours of pollin?. will, if necessary, be given at a future date. F. G. MOORE, Returning Officer. Masterton, 12th December, 1906. REMOVAL NOTICE.
